(Sharecast News) - Intellectual property-based business investor IP Group said on Wednesday that two of its portfolio companies had been acquired by US-listed firms.
Portfolio company Inivata, a leader in liquid biopsy, will be acquired by Nasdaq-listed NeoGenomics for $390.0m, with IP Group set to receive approximately $91.0m in cash or, potentially, NeoGenomics stock, at the group's election.
IP Group expects the transaction to result in an increase in the net asset value of the company of approximately £28.0m.
Elsewhere, Kuur Therapeutics was acquired by Athenex, a global biopharmaceutical company, for a total potential consideration of $185.0m, with Athenex set to pay $70.0m upfront to Kuur shareholders, former employees and directors, comprised primarily of equity in Athenex common stock.
As a result, IP Group will receive £30.0m in Athenex stock and was also eligible to receive up to a further £52.0m in milestone payments in cash or stock.
